11.10 Coal Cleaning 11.10.1 Process Description1-2,9 Coal cleaning is a process by which impurities such as sulfur, ash, and rock are removed from coal to upgrade its value. Safe coal handling practices are designed to ensure that the fuel remains intact throughout its journey from the mine until the point at which it is ignited in the boiler. It takes as little as 1.4 kg (3 lbs) of pulverised coal in 28 m3 (1,000 ft3) of air to form an explosive mixture.

Coal Transportation Since the distance between the energy supply point and the energy demand point for coal is often long, many coal utilization projects require that transporta tion technology and costs be considered.
